Introduction

  • We are a vibrant arts space in the heart of Belfast’s Cathedral Quarter.
    The Black Box was established in 2006 as an alternative, fringe-style theatre space. We are now one of the leading lights of the city’s arts and entertainment sector and over the last two decades, our dedication to accessibility, quality and innovation have made us one of the most beloved venues in town with audiences and artists alike. We are passionate about removing barriers to accessing great events and improving the ability for all to experience, enjoy and engage with the arts. We programme and present work across all platforms, from music, literature, and theatre, to film, comedy, live art, cabaret and talks.
    Most importantly, we provide a unique incubation space for emerging artists, curators and promoters to experiment and try out great new ideas, laying the groundwork for the future of our arts sector.
    As a not-for-profit arts venue, the Black Box works closely with community initiatives, as well as with many of Belfast’s highest-profile festivals. Looking ahead to our third decade, we want to build our role as a catalyst and greenhouse for Belfast’s most exciting creative talent and to play a vital role in the city’s arts offer as a partner, programmer and home-from-home for artists and audiences.
  • Here at Black Box, we aim to provide a great time for everyone. Below are some things you may want to keep in mind if you require any further assistance when you arrive.
    The Black Box is an inclusive venue and we welcome D/deaf and disabled audiences and artists to the venue.
    The Black Box has step-free access throughout the whole building from the street and has fitted accessible push button automatic doors.
    We welcome any customers that may require to bring medication, food or drink, or medical equipment to manage a medical condition. We also have ear plugs available behind the bars in the venue for those who need them- just ask a member of staff when you are here.
    We welcome assistance/emotional support dogs into the venue. If you plan on bringing one with you, please do let us know in advance.
    Occasionally some of our events use strobe lighting. Events using strobe lighting will have this warning in the description online and warning signs would be put up around the venue. If you have any concerns, please let us know.
    Our dressing room for performers is located on ground level across from accessible toilet facilities. We also have a portable ramp that can be attached to the stage for any performers who require it. Please let us know ahead of your visit to the venue. Our staff team is trained in Disability Equity training and all our outreach and projects are disabled lead and we welcome all. We are a Bronze Charter accredited venue with Attitude is Everything, and have been awarded certification from Deafblind UK as a deafblind-friendly venue.

Regular Accessible Events

  • Black Moon night club - Held once a month, this is a disabled-led club for, and by, adults with learning disabilities - for more information please visithttps://www.facebook.com/Blackmoonblackbox
  • Drop-in - Express Yourself Social Cafe happens on a Tuesday afternoon from 14:00 - 16:00 and is a creative gathering of people who identify as having a learning disability and/or autism.
  • Gig Buddies - A project for adults with learning disabilities and/or autism to attend gigs with their buddies and be part of the Gig Buddies Belfast community For More information, please visithttps://www.blackboxbelfast.com/gig-buddies-projects/gig-buddies-belfast

  • Comments View
    • PA/Carer Tickets are available for free. Please contact the venue for further information.
    • The Black Box does not have a set viewing area however, if you have access requirements, please contact the venue before your visit and they can reserve a space for you.
    • Upon your arrival, the manager on duty will be there to assist you in finding a place for you to position yourself for the show.

  • Comments View
    • Please note that booking is required for Audio Description / BSL / ISL and accessible formats for Black Box programmed events.
    • The Black Box is a host venue for many events programmed by independent festivals and promoters. Access requirements for events programmed by external partners would be via the event organiser/promoter. You can find out who to contact by clicking on the event/ticket link.
